    Tracey Emin’s My Bed Returns to Tate Modern in 2026: Does It Still Shock?

    Tracey Emin’s My Bed returns to Tate Modern in spring 2026, nearly three decades after its explosive debut. Once a Turner Prize controversy, the installation of crumpled sheets, bottles, and personal relics challenged what art could be. Has it lost its shock factor, or does it still hold the same raw power today?

    NFA: No Fixed Abode

    Liverpool-based conceptual artist Alison Little created NFA (No Fixed Abode) for the Outside the Box exhibition in Manchester (2015). Using polythene forms stuffed with shredded paper and inscribed with words linked to homelessness, the installation explores themes of rough sleeping, displacement, and survival.
